Welcome to Homeschool Java! I’m glad you’re here!! My name is Erin, and I’m a homeschooling mom of two little girls (ages 6 and 4). My husband, Phil, and I celebrated our 10th anniversary this summer.

I never thought I would homeschool my kids. I just didn’t think I could pull it off. So often God sees more in us than we see in ourselves. By the time our oldest was ready for K4, we knew it was the way we were supposed to go. We are now in our third year of homeschool, with M in 1st grade and E in kindergarten.

If you were with me in person, I would love to sit down with a cozy cup of coffee and share our homeschooling journey. My hope for Homeschool Java is that it will be a place where I can have an ongoing conversation with you as I share our ups and downs and lessons learned. I’m certainly no expert. Every day brings new challenges and perspectives, and I’m constantly learning and growing through the experience. I hope that what I share here brings you encouragement and maybe even some help in your homeschooling journey, whether you’re a seasoned homeschooler or wondering if homeschool is the right choice for you!

God has amazing ways of surprising us, and blogging has been one of those surprises for me. I started writing at my first blog, Closing Time rather reluctantly, after reading other mom’s blogs for about two years. I didn’t know where it would take me, and I didn’t even know I was “supposed” to have a niche! The journey has taken me down unexpected paths, introducing me to some incredible new friends, and even leading me to launch my own blog design business, Insight Blog Design.
